Lauren Morris, a recipient of the 2025 Trudy Haynes Scholarship from CBS News Philadelphia, delivered a speech at her graduation from Temple University's Klein College of Media and Communication. The scholarship, awarded by CBS News Philadelphia, recognizes
outstanding students in the field of media and communication. Morris, who has expressed a strong interest in pursuing a career in journalism, was honored for her academic achievements and potential in the media industry. Her speech at the graduation ceremony highlighted her journey and aspirations in journalism, marking a significant milestone in her academic career.
